Making money online can be a viable option, but it's important to approach it with the right mindset and expectations.
Here are some tips for earning money online: Identify Your Skills and Interests: Start by assessing your skills, talents, and interests. What are you good at? What do you enjoy doing? This will help you choose the right online money-making opportunity.
Freelancing: Platforms like Upwork, Freelancer, and Fiverr allow you to offer your skills as a freelancer. You can provide services such as writing, graphic design, web development, and more. Online Surveys and Market Research: Participate in online surveys and market research studies. Websites like swag bucks, Survey Junkie, and Vandals Research pay users for sharing their opinions. Content Creation: If you're good at creating content, consider starting a blog, YouTube channel, or podcast. You can monetize these platforms through ads, sponsorships, and affiliate marketing. Affiliate Marketing: Promote products or services through affiliate programs. You earn a commission for each sale or lead generated through your referral. Online Selling: Sell products on platforms like eBay, Amazon, Etsy, or Shopify. You can sell physical products, digital products, or even drop-ship items.
Online Tutoring or Teaching: If you have expertise in a particular subject, you can offer online tutoring or create and sell online courses on platforms like Udemy, Teachable, or Coursera. Remote Work: Many companies offer remote job opportunities. Look for remote job listings on websites like Remote.co, Flex Jobs, or We Work Remotely. Investing: Consider investing in stocks, cryptocurrencies, or other assets through online trading platforms. Remember that investing carries risks, so it's essential to do your research.
Content Writing: If you have strong writing skills, you can write articles, e-books, or website content for clients or content marketplaces. Drop-shipping: Start an online store and partner with suppliers to drop-ship products. You don't need to hold inventory, and you only purchase items when you make a sale. Virtual Assistance: Offer administrative, customer service, or other virtual assistant services to businesses or entrepreneurs. Online Gaming and Streaming: If you're into gaming or have unique skills or knowledge to share, platforms like Twitch or YouTube Gaming allow you to monetize your content and engage with your audience.
Cryptocurrency and Blockchain: Explore opportunities in the cryptocurrency and blockchain space, such as trading, mining, or participating in decentralized finance (DeFi) projects. Stock Photography and Video: If you're a photographer or videographer, you can sell your work on stock media websites like Shutterstock or Adobe Stock. App and Website Testing: Sign up for user testing platforms like User Testing or Tryout. To test websites and apps and provide feedback for pay. Remote Consulting: Offer consulting services in your area of expertise, such as business, marketing, or personal development. Remember that success in making money online often requires time, effort, and persistence. Be cautious of scams and schemes promising quick riches. Always do your research, invest in your skills and knowledge, and approach online earning opportunities with a realistic mindset. It's also a good idea to diversify your income streams to reduce risk.
